  3. German Shepherd -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/German_Shepherd

    [85] [87] A North American study analysing more than 1,000,000 hip and 250,000 elbow scans in dogs over the age of two found the German Shepherd Dog to have a rate of hip and elbow dysplasia to be 18.9% and 17.8% respectively. The German Shepherd had the 8th highest rate of hip dysplasia and 6th highest rate of elbow dysplasia. [88]

  7. White Shepherd -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/White_Shepherd

    According to the breed standard of the United Kennel Club, the ideal height of a White Shepherd dog is 25 inches (64 cm) and the ideal weight is between 75 and 85 pounds (34 and 39 kg), while bitches ideally stand 23 inches (58 cm) and weigh between 60 and 70 pounds (27 and 32 kg). [3]

  8. White Swiss Shepherd Dog -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/White_Swiss_Shepherd_Dog

    The White Swiss Shepherd is of medium size, with a weight in the range 25–40 kg and a height at the withers usually between 53 and 66 cm. [1]: 68 Two types of coat are seen, medium-length and long; the coat is always white, preferably with dark skin. [6]
